DJ Earworm – United States of Pop 2009

BoomBoomChikers, my bad for my disappearing act as of late, been busy! I came across this mashup rather late as it was released in December by DJ Earworm, a mashup artist. Earworm is known for his end-of-the-year mashups of the top 25 songs of the year on Billboard magazine. This mashup is considered his best [...]

Nocando: LA’s Underground Emcee

Nocando, a seasoned member of the underground hip hop community, brings fresh rhymes every week at the world-renowned club night Low End Theory where he is the resident host. He won the MC Battle at the 2007 Scribble Jam, the largest hip hop festival in the nation. His voice is very laid back and [...]

Introducing Esperanza Spalding

2009 has been a blessed year for musician Esperanza Spalding who has recently garnered much attention after being invited by President Obama to perform at the Nobel Prize giving ceremony. Spalding is a 25-year-old bassist/singer songwriter from Oregon who discovered music early on in life. After getting her GED at 16, she enrolled at Portland [...]

Free Download: Karina Pasian – Perfectly Different

Karina Pasian first hit the soundwaves in spring of 2008 with the single “16 @ War” off of her Grammy-nominated debut album, First Love. In anticipation for her sophomore album, this young chanteuse has blessed us all with a free download of her new song called “Perfectly Different”. Karina does best when accompanied by few [...]
